With a larger screen size than Beovision 3000, Beovision 3800 looked very similar to the TV that it replaced. Fitted in a more sedate rosewood or teak veneered cabinet, this TV was a little easier to place than its more modern-looking Beovision 3502 and 3802 which could be ordered in either aubergine or white. Bang & Olufsen has always had the philosophy of giving customers a choice hence the introduction of this model.
Customers also had a choice of two undercarriages on which to place it: either a 42cm tall stand or a slightly lower one at 34cm.
Beovision 7000 replaced this particular model at the end of its life.
Technical data for Beovision 3800 
Additional data for Beovision 3900 
Types: 3504, 3505 (1978 - Oct 1980) 
Picture tube: 56cm (nominal) 20AX in-line High Bright 
Start time: Approx 5 seconds 
Tuning: 8 pre-sets with AFC; UHF channels 21-68 
Aerial input: 75 ohms co-ax 
Sound output: 6,5W RMS 
Harmonic distortion: <0,8% 
Frequency response: 60 - 15KHz +/- 1,5dB (amplifier) 
Bass control: +/- 5dB/100Hz 
Treble control: +/-10dB/10000Hz 
Optional accessories: 
Undercarriage - 34cm high: type 3058 
Undercarriage - 42cm high: type 3057 
Headphone/ext. speaker kit: 8003207 
Tape/amplifier kit: 8003208 
Dimensions (HxWxD): 43 x 67,5 x 40,5cm 
Power supply: 180 - 265V AC 50Hz 
Power consumption: 110W 
Weight: 28 kg
